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
---|---|
$57,375.00 or less | 15% |
$57,375.00 - $114,749.99 | 20.5% |
$114,750.00 - $177,881.99 | 26% |
$177,882.00 - $253,413.99 | 29% |
More than $253,414.00 | 33% |
British Columbia Tax Bracket | British Columbia Tax Rates |
---|---|
$49,279.00 or less | 5.06% |
$49,279.00 - $98,559.99 | 7.7% |
$98,560.00 - $113,157.99 | 10.5% |
$113,158.00 - $137,406.99 | 12.29% |
$137,407.00 - $186,305.99 | 14.7% |
$186,306.00 - $259,828.99 | 16.8% |
More than $259,829.00 | 20.5% |
